What are the key Louisiana state laws I should know before buying a firearm in Slagle?

Louisiana is a permitless carry state, meaning no permit is required for concealed carry for those 18 and older, but you must be 21 to purchase a handgun from a licensed dealer. There is no waiting period for firearm purchases, and private sales do not require a background check, though all FFL dealers must conduct one. It's important to note that Louisiana state law preempts local ordinances, so regulations are consistent in Slagle as elsewhere in the state.

Do I need a permit to purchase a handgun or long gun in Slagle, LA?

No, Louisiana does not require a permit to purchase handguns or long guns. However, you must be at least 18 to buy a long gun and 21 to buy a handgun from an FFL dealer. All purchases from licensed dealers in Slagle, such as The Gun Runner or Fort Polk Guns & Ammo, require a federal background check via the NICS system at the point of sale.

Can I complete a private party firearm transfer in Slagle, and are there any restrictions?

Yes, private party firearm transfers are legal in Louisiana and can be conducted in Slagle without a background check or involving an FFL, as state law does not require it. However, it is illegal to knowingly sell a firearm to a prohibited person, such as a felon or someone with a domestic violence restraining order. For added security, you can voluntarily use a local FFL, like Beauregard Pawn & Gun, to process the transfer and conduct a background check.
